Puppy with Giardia won't drink water. How can I get him to drink?

Updated on September 23rd, 2025

Pet's info: Dog | Mixed Breed Small (up to 22lb) | Male | neutered | 7.1 lbs

My 4 month old puppy is being treated for Giardia. He is eating fine but stopped drinking from his water bowl. I used another bowl and he drank from it once or twice last night, but this AM he sniffs around the bowl, the bowl & water but won’t drink. I put some chicken broth in the water which worked at first but he’s back to nit drinking again. I have 2 bowls set out for him - one metal and one ceramic. How can I get him back to drinking? I’ve been using filtered water & tried bottled water.

Is he eating? Is he acting energetic? If he is eating and acting normally, I wouldn't be too concerned--he's likely getting enough fluids. He's pretty small so it won't necessarily look like much is gone from the bowl. However, if he doesn't want to eat or if he seems to be feeling dumpy, take him to your vet for an exam.
